PMID 32325141: single individual with de novo missense and phenotype primarily characterised by severe neutropenia.

PMID 28782633: 11 individuals with primarily CVID phenotype, including neutropenia.

Two families with primarily renal phenotype, some haem/immunological abnormalities (one with neutropaenia). Two families predominantly with hypogammaglobulinaemia, and one presenting with congenital neutropaenia. May represent same disorder with different manifestations depending on age/ascertainment, or neutropenia may be linked to particular variants, unclear at present due to low number of families reported.
